Lin v. Radel
Plaintiff: Suting Lin
Defendant: David M. Radel
Case Number: 1:2024cv00168
Filed: April 12, 2024
Court: US District Court for the District of Hawaii
Presiding Judge: WES REBER PORTER
Referring Judge: DERRICK K WATSON
Nature of Suit: Other Immigration Actions
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1361 Petition for Writ of Mandamus
Jury Demanded By: None
